Caliber and Capacity

The caliber is the size of the bullet and will impact the recoil and stopping power of the revolver. A .357 Magnum, for example, offers strong stopping power but has a noticeable kick. On the other hand, a .38 Special might have less recoil, making it easier to control.

Capacity refers to how many rounds the revolver can hold. Most revolvers have a cylinder that holds between five and eight rounds. Balancing caliber and capacity is key when looking at modern firearms for your safety.

Size and Weight

When it comes to size and weight, it’s important to find a revolver that feels comfortable in your hand. A smaller, lighter revolver is easier to carry and handle, especially for long periods. However, smaller guns can have more recoil, which might make them harder to shoot accurately.

On the other hand, larger, heavier revolvers usually have less recoil and can be more accurate, but they might be harder to carry around. Finding the right balance between size and weight will help you make the best choice for your needs.

Personal Preference and Comfort

Choosing a revolver is a very personal decision. What feels good in one person’s hand might not feel right in another’s. It’s important to hold and test different models to see what feels best to you. Look for a grip that fits comfortably in your hand without feeling too big or too small.

The weight should feel balanced, and you should be able to manage the recoil without much effort. Remember, the right revolver is the one that feels most natural and safe for you to use.
